Description
Crispy, savory Holiday Ritz Crackers coated in a flavorful blend of melted butter, Ranch seasoning, Parmesan cheese, garlic, and red pepper flakes. Perfect as a festive snack or party appetizer, these crackers bake quickly to golden perfection for a deliciously addictive treat.
Ingredients
Scale
Crackers
- 1 box Ritz crackers (about 32–36 crackers)
Topping
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 1 packet Ranch dressing mix
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 tablespoon red pepper flakes
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
Instructions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 300°F (150°C) and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per or foil to ensure easy cleanup.
- Arrange crackers: Spread the Ritz crackers out in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et to ensure even cooking.
- Make the topping: In a medium bowl, whisk together the melted butter, Ranch dressing mix, grated Parmesan cheese, red pepper flakes, and garlic powder until fully combined.
- Coat the crackers: Spoon or brush the buttery topping evenly over each cracker, making sure they are generously coated for maximum flavor.
- Bake: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for 8–10 minutes, or until the crackers turn golden and the topping bubbles lightly.
- Cool and serve: Remove from oven and let the crackers cool for at least 5 minutes so they crisp up properly before serving. Enjoy immediately or store in an airtight container for later.
Notes
- For extra spice, add more red pepper flakes according to your taste.
- You can substitute Parmesan cheese with nutritional yeast for a dairy-free option.
- Store leftover crackers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days to maintain crispness.
